# 25 U.S.C. § 377 - Repealed. Pub. L. 96363, § 2(a), Sept. 26, 1980, 94 Stat. 1207
## Notes
Section, acts Jan. 24, 1923, ch. 42, 42 Stat. 1185; May 29, 1928, ch. 901, § 1(84), 45 Stat. 992, related to payment or deduction from trust funds, etc., of cost of determining heirs, and set forth a schedule of fees.
Statutory Notes and Related Subsidiaries
Cancellation of Assessed Unpaid FeesPub. L. 96363, § 2(b), Sept. 26, 1980, 94 Stat. 1207, provided that: “The Secretary of the Interior may cancel any unpaid fees assessed under the provisions repealed by this section [sections 375b and 377 of this title].”
